Syncing never come back if doze is enabled

Hello,

on my Z3+ ( Android 6.0 / Build: 32.1.A.1.185)  syncing of calendar does never come back if doze (Setting - Battery usage - ... - Battery saver - on ) is enabeld.

Steps to reproduce:

1. Turn on Battery saver and try to sync   => it  never come back.

2. Turn off  Battery saver and try to sync  =>  it takes only 1 or 2 Seconds and sync is finished.

So my question is .... is the a known bug ? Or is the synchronistion blocked for most of the time if doze is enabled

I have update to Android 6.0 immediately after starting the z3+ for the first time and after it was finished i have reset it an start using it normal.

Booting into safe mode does not change the behaviour  !!  With Battery save "on" no sync is done

What should I do ?

After reading the specification of Android 6.0 I must correct myself.

In fact ... Doze is _always_ enabled you can only "whitelist" some applications under some circumstances.

The additional "battery-Saving" options must be some add-on of sony.
